In addition to creating the Retirement Education Hour podcast, instructors from the Retirement Education Foundation also produce The Rundown, a educational video series featuring timely information for making informed decisions in and approaching retirement.
In this clip, Kirk and Michael describe behavioral finance, which is a study of economics. They explain four types of biases that consumers face when thinking about their finances:
Overconfidence Bias
Hindsight Bias
Confirmation Bias
Herd Behavior
